I started my journey to Zamfara state on July 4, 2021, I boarded a night bus to Abuja from Ibadan.I entered abuja around pass 5am in the morning, from abuja i boarded a car going to Sokoto and i alighted at gusau, i entered cattle market straight because their market day is every Monday and Friday. i have been to different states with different market in northern state but zamfara was the worst state i have ever been to.

i went to zamfara state for sallah rams, reason i choose zamfara state was that it's very close to south west than taraba and Adamawa state because my journey to Adamawa state in last month, i bought some rams from mubi animal market with cheapest price but those animals suffered due to long distance, that's reason i choose zamfara state.

we were three in number, those two brothers were from osun state while i came from ibadan, we worked together as a team.

we used gusau animal market as our based for our animals for feeding and security, on my first day, i bought 12 rams because i intended to buy almost 100 rams. on the second day which was Tuesday, on getting to the market two of my rams was missing, we searched everywhere, i saw one, i didn't see the other one. we left to another market which was very close to Sokoto state, it was 2 hour journey from gusau to the market.

on getting to the market, we paid for transport and one of us lost almost 100k in the car, we searched everywhere but no where to be found, immediately we entered the market, i was terrified about population of fulanis in the market because in southern state we believed that the fulanis are the bandit.i stayed outside the market to monitored the environment because i feared for my life o, also 200k was stolen from the second brother. I spent 6 days in that state and my findings are as follows:

1. There are a lot of thieves in the state, that's reason when you buy cows in that state, you must collect the receipt and the seller must take a picture with cow and attach to the receipt

2. zamfara, kastina and Sokoto are not secured for business, I prefer going to Maiduguri than going to those states

3. on the day we decided to leave the state, after I loaded my rams into the truck, I discovered that 2 of my rams food has missed, I called one of the market management and I explained everything to him that they have stolen my rams food which per a bag was 7k, the guy reported it to seriki of the market, seriki called the police to arrest those boys in the market, fortunately, one of the boys revealed where the food was, to the guy I reported to.
The guy made one statement that I will never forget that, " did you expect these people to come back to zamfara state to buy market with their bad experience" the fact is that I will think twice before I go to zamfara for another business

When I got to Ibadan, I thanked God for saving my life when I heard that some people also travel from Ibadan to northern state (name withheld) after they bought all their rams, they were killed in the market and all their rams were taking away by bandit.

Adamawa has 4 types of bag:
A. Small bag for oloyin beans

B. Big big for oloyin, olootu, groundnut,paddy rice, it's 70kg to 75kg

C. 100kg bag for maize, soughum,soya beans etc, has no cover on top of the bag

D. 125kg bag for maize, soughum, soya beans etc, has a cover on top of a bag

@the OP, you are a good guy, all what you are writing here will go a long way to help anyone that wants to venture into grains business, I lived in the north for 14 years (from my teenage years) and speaks Hausa fluently,I am Igbo and business has taken me to virtually all the states in the north.

North East and Central are the food basket of the north, forget all the noise that the North west makes all the time, they only know politics while the main riches of the north is in the North East and North Central.
Taraba state is a hidden treasure for agro business, last year I was at Mutum biyu, Garba chede, Mayo kam, Mai hula, Bali, Mararaba, Takum, I even went as far as the fringes of the Mambilla mountains buying soya beans. Niger and Adamawa states are next on my list of criss crossing this year by God's grace, heavy agricultural business thrives in those states.
